At last, someone that shares my opinion. I found the game fun at first but very repetative and unappealing, I finished it in 21 hours on a 2 night rental with most of the extras done as well so I definatley won't be buying this one. Rent it first becuase the game does not appeal to everybody.

Get Spiderman for the Xbox NOT PS2. The Xbox version has smoother graphics and 2 extra levels. Xbox version is the best out of ALL 3 so get that version rather then the PS2.

I didn't get any slowdown, but there was a nice sense of speed the game created as it pulled the camera away from the rider. thats the first time a game has made me feel i'm actually getting some speed, rathere than burnout and others where the surroundings just fly past and you know a crash is predictable.
With moto GP, I was actually slowing myself down rather than getting assistance from those wonderfully helpful walls.
